Re: Retirement of the Stonebriar product line

Stonebriar sales have declined for five consecutive quarters and support costs now exceed contribution margin. The retirement plan is staged: new orders close end of Q2, existing contracts honoured through their terms, and spares stocked for twenty-four months. Sales leads should steer prospects toward the Ashgrove range; migration incentives are already approved. Customer comms are drafted and awaiting legal sign-off. The forward strategy behind this decision is set out in the note below.

confidential, yafog-hagug: Gross margin on Druix came in at 10 percent against a plan of 15 percent. Only 5 of the 80 pilot accounts renewed Druix, so a churn review is set for October 1.

Release checklist — spoolerd v2.9 (Lanber Systems). Before promoting, confirm the drain sequence: pause intake, let the queue flush (watch queued_jobs hit zero, typically under four minutes), then swap the deployment. If any job sticks past five minutes, abort and re-enable intake — partial drains corrupted job metadata in v2.7. Verify the health probe returns ready on both replicas after swap. Record the promoted build reference below this entry.

build token for haduf-bafog: htk21_2d98ce91a83676b65394a

// WATER_CYCLE_MAX_SECONDS caps a single watering run for the Sproutline
// scheduler. Security note: this constant is the only guard against a stuck
// relay flooding a greenhouse bay if the moisture sensor feed from the
// Fernwick gateway goes stale. It is compiled in, not configurable at
// runtime, so tampering requires a new signed build. Any change must be
// reviewed by the hardware-safety group at Verdalia Systems before merge.
// The signed build that last modified this value is recorded below.

build token for fajof-yahof: htk4_869f

## Artifact Signing — ChipGate Reader Firmware

Firmware for the ChipGate marathon timing-chip reader must be signed before field units will accept an update. Build the image with the release profile, run the antenna calibration self-test in the emulator, and record the build hash in the release log. Unsigned images brick the bootloader check and require manual recovery at the Fennwick depot. Sign every release image with the key below.

release key, hadug-kawef: bky13_mPGeFZeR1GZ1G